R3.6.3下载 Rstudio下载及安装,网盘链接永久有效

您所在的位置:网站首页 hyperattack价格 R3.6.3下载 Rstudio下载及安装,网盘链接永久有效

R3.6.3下载 Rstudio下载及安装,网盘链接永久有效

2023-09-12 06:26| 来源: 网络整理| 查看: 265

scrapy装饰器的@inline_requests是什么意思,有什么作用?

朴拙数科: 谢谢补充,是这样的,Scrapy-Redis分布式框架与@inline_requests装饰器存在冲突,因为@inline_requests装饰器是用于在Scrapy中使用异步请求的方便方法。然而,Scrapy-Redis分布式框架使用了自定义的调度器和请求队列,与@inline_requests不兼容。 如果您在使用Scrapy-Redis分布式框架时需要异步请求,可以考虑使用twisted.inlineCallbacks装饰器来实现类似的功能。以下是一个示例: from scrapy_redis.spiders import RedisSpider from twisted.internet.defer import inlineCallbacks class MySpider(RedisSpider): name = 'my_spider' def parse(self, response): # 在这里编写解析代码 pass @inlineCallbacks def process_request(self, request, spider): response = yield self.crawler.engine.download(request, spider) yield self.parse(response) 在上述示例中,我们使用twisted.inlineCallbacks装饰器来实现异步请求。process_request方法是Scrapy-Redis分布式框架中用于处理请求的方法,我们在该方法上应用了@inlineCallbacks装饰器,使其支持异步操作。 使用twisted.inlineCallbacks装饰器需要正确配置Twisted和Scrapy-Redis框架。

scrapy装饰器的@inline_requests是什么意思,有什么作用?

54山村野人: 如果是scrapy-redis分布式,使用调度器SCHEDULER = "scrapy_redis.scheduler.Scheduler",装饰器@inline_requests就用不了了

用LDA主题模型并进行可视化

朴拙数科: 这个错误通常是由于你没有安装pyLDAvis的gensim_models模块引起的。尝试在命令行中运行以下命令以安装该模块: 复制代码pip install pyLDAvis[gensim] 如果问题仍然存在,请确保你的环境与pyLDAvis需要的依赖项兼容。你可以在pyLDAvis的官网上找到更多关于安装和使用的信息。

用LDA主题模型并进行可视化

朴拙数科: 没安这个可视化库

用LDA主题模型并进行可视化

Raelene Liang: 想问一下可视化过程中报错ModuleNotFoundError: No module named 'pyLDAvis.gensim_models'是什么原因啊?



【本文地址】


今日新闻


推荐新闻


C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3